Basic Vector Information
- Vector Name:
- pGDR11-DV
- Antibiotic Resistance:
- Ampicillin
- Length:
- 7084 bp
- Type:
- Expression vector
- Replication origin:
- ori
- Source/Author:
- Dunn MR, Otto CE, Fenton KE, Chaput JC.
